Output 29d88e071995c60c19b0db28b72d789599368594ff4bc7a8007b69cc70acd419:3

value
287009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bed46fc3231d1ab005b934c8ed84ca56aca458c1 OP_EQUAL
address
3K62oLs2bAugkpoXXbw3pKpkmF67cDjcTZ
transaction
29d88e071995c60c19b0db28b72d789599368594ff4bc7a8007b69cc70acd419
confirmations
302915
spent
true